What Is a Flight Change Policy and How Does It Work
A flight change policy defines how passengers can modify travel dates, times, or routes after booking. Airlines like Air France calculate adjustments based on fare rules, seat availability, and timing of the request.
- Changes depend on fare class and ticket conditions
- Fare difference may apply even if change fees are waived
- Some promotional fares are non-changeable
- Higher-tier fares offer more flexibility

Fare Types and Change Eligibility
Fare structure plays the biggest role in determining change costs.
- Light Fare: Most restrictions, often non-changeable
- Standard Fare: Change allowed with fees and fare difference
- Flex Fare: Minimal or no change fees
- Business Fare: High flexibility for modifications

How to Change a Flight Online Step by Step
Air France allows passengers to modify bookings through its official website or mobile app in just a few steps.
- Log in to your booking account
- Select “My Trips” and choose your flight
- Click “Modify Flight” or air france booking modification
- Select new dates or times
- Review fare difference and confirm changes

Can you change the person who is going on a flight?
Generally, Air France does not allow full passenger name transfers to another person after booking. Minor spelling corrections may be permitted, but changing the traveler entirely is usually not allowed due to security and ticketing rules. In most cases, you would need to cancel and rebook a new ticket.
Can airlines change your flight without asking?
Yes, airlines including Air France can change your flight schedule due to operational needs such as weather, route adjustments, or aircraft changes. When this happens, passengers are usually notified in advance and offered alternatives like rebooking, refunds, or accepting the updated itinerary depending on how significant the schedule change is.
